If your window won't stay up when you open it you will probably need a window sash balance repair. What this entails is to buy a new window sash to replace the one currently in your window frame. You will want to make sure that the sash balance is rated to carry the weight of the sash in your window.
According to the dictionary and wikipedia, storm windows are secondary windows installed to provide additional protection from harsh weather. These windows can be installed outside or inside of the normal windows in a home. In the past these windows were in wood frames and could be taken down during warmer weather so that the windows of the home could be opened to let in air from outside.
